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
768 61639063 5421213685 33069610 26339950678
100406179 4750763
100406179 4750763
52994 1547 401 956
All about undefined
Interested in learning more?
100406179 4750763
52994 1547 401 956
See more
6791327470 734632
36883 626 254 93
See more
649721809 83333537 8083034
67530 018152 477363597 36643
See more